PLOW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review
132 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Douglas Dynamics (PLOW)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$734M — down 12% from $830M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 20 funds closed out of PLOW and 15 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 42 trimmed existing stakes and 60 added.
The largest buyer was Allspring Global Investments, adding an estimated $4.84M. The largest seller was Granahan Investment Management, cutting an estimated $9.26M.
